OBITUARY: Thomas Ray Colanero

Thomas Ray Colanero, age 73 of Lebanon, Tennessee passed away peacefully at his home on September 20, 2023.

Tom ear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Chemical Engineering from West Virginia Institute of Technology in 1972 and enjoyed a successful career in the chemical industry for 45 years. Tom is remembered for his joyful disposition, sense of humor, and wisdom.

He was a friend and neighbor to all and had the most generous spirit. He loved golfing, fishing, reading and was always outside with his dogs or completing DIY projects around his home. Most importantly, he was a proud husband, father and grandfather. He loved spending his time with family, especially his granddaughters. Reading to them, playing with them, and seeing them smile made his day.

Tom was born in Monongah, WV to Elizabeth Milush and Philip Colanero.

In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by his brother, Philip J. Colanero, Jr.

He is survived by his wife of nearly 40 years, Juliet Khuri Colanero; his son and his wife, Christopher and Rose Colanero; his granddaughters, Adira Rey and Leia Rose Colanero; his “bonus son” Wani Hakim; his three sisters and their husbands, Paulette & John Paul O’Connor, Annette & Mark Davis, Cathy & Mike Johnson and brother James & Debbie Colanero; and his cherished pets, Peyton and Moses.

A memorial service will be held on Saturday, September 30, 2023 in the chapel of Sellars Funeral Home in Lebanon, TN. The Family will be receiving friends at the Funeral Home from 1:00 p.m. until the service begins at 2:00 p.m.

In lieu of flowers, the family would appreciate donations to the Tunnel to Towers Foundation, a cause that was dear to Tom’s heart.
